From 3b925b58f2a80c8c8fccec969d631205ee3e255d Mon Sep 17 00:00:00 2001
From: "Mr.jiang" <714156421@qq.com>
Date: Mon, 22 Jul 2024 10:05:30 +0800
Subject: [PATCH] =?UTF-8?q?=E7=A7=92=E6=9D=80=20=E8=A7=86=E9=A2=91?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
my/order/payModifyMs.vue | 24 +-
my/order/paydingMs.vue | 1646 ++++++++++++++++++++++++++++++++
pages.json | 9 +
pages/my/newseckill.vue | 75 +-
pages/my/newseckilldetails.vue | 10 +-
pages/videoCircle/index.vue | 1151 ++++++++++++++--------
pages/videoCircle/index111.vue | 762 ---------------
pages/videoCircle/index22.vue | 451 +++++++++
8 files changed, 2896 insertions(+), 1232 deletions(-)
create mode 100644 my/order/paydingMs.vue
delete mode 100644 pages/videoCircle/index111.vue
create mode 100644 pages/videoCircle/index22.vue
diff --git a/my/order/payModifyMs.vue b/my/order/payModifyMs.vue
index c23e962..813bb7f 100644
--- a/my/order/payModifyMs.vue
+++ b/my/order/payModifyMs.vue
@@ -289,28 +289,32 @@
goOrder() {//生成orderId
let that = this
console.log('asdasd',that.couponId)
- // let payMoney =item.price;
- // let payMoney = that.isVip ? item.memberPrice : item.price;
let data = {
userId: uni.getStorageSync('userId'),
+ groupNo:'',
+ isNewer:that.orderXm.isNewer==null?'0':that.orderXm.isNewer,
+ startTime:that.orderXm.startTime,
+ endTime:that.orderXm.endTime,
couponId: that.couponId,
- oldSumMoney: that.orderXm.oldPrice,
- sumMoney: that.orderXm.price,
- // oldSumMoney: that.mainData.oldPrice*that.detailData.length,
- // sumMoney: that.mainData.price*that.detailData.length,
+ orders:'',
ordersPackageList:[
{packageId: that.orderXm.id,num: that.number},
- ]
+ ],
+ // oldSumMoney: that.orderXm.oldPrice,
+ // sumMoney: that.orderXm.price,
+ // oldSumMoney: that.mainData.oldPrice*that.detailData.length,
+ // sumMoney: that.mainData.price*that.detailData.length,
+
}
- that.$Request.postJson("/app/user/package/order/insertOrders", data).then(res => {
+ that.$Request.postJson("/app/user/package/order/insertFlashOrders", data).then(res => {
that.showorder = false
if (res.code == 0) {
that.tordersId = res.data.ordersId;
that.tpayMoney = res.data.payMoney;
// that.showpay = true;
- that.paySel = 1;
+ // that.paySel = 1;
uni.navigateTo({
- url:'/my/order/paydingTc?ordersId='+ res.data.ordersId
+ url:'/my/order/paydingMs?ordersId='+ res.data.ordersId
})
} else {
that.$queue.showToast(res.msg)
diff --git a/my/order/paydingMs.vue b/my/order/paydingMs.vue
new file mode 100644
index 0000000..e628076
--- /dev/null
+++ b/my/order/paydingMs.vue
@@ -0,0 +1,1646 @@
+
+
+
+ (订单已超时)
+
+
+
+
+ {{orderXm.type=='104'?'服务套餐':orderXm.type=='105'?'项目次卡':'服务疗程'}}
+
+
+
+
+
+
+
+ {{order.ordersPackageList[0].title}}
+
+
+ 待支付
+
+
+
+
+
+ ¥
+ {{order.ordersPackageList[0].price}}
+
+
+
+
+
+
+
+
+
+
+
+
+ 订单编号
+
+ {{order.ordersNo}}
+
+
+
+
+
+
+ 费用明细
+
+
+ {{orderXm.type=='104'?'套餐':orderXm.type=='105'?'次卡':'疗程'}}价格
+ ¥{{order.sumMoney}}
+
+
+ {{orderXm.type=='104'?'套餐':orderXm.type=='105'?'次卡':'疗程'}}数量
+ {{order.ordersPackageList[0].num}}
+
+
+ 优惠券
+ -¥{{order.couponMoney}}
+
+
+ 会员减免
+ -¥{{order.vipReductionMoney}}
+
+
+
+ 总金额
+ ¥{{order.payMoney}}
+
+
+
+
+
+
+
+ 立即支付
+
+ 联系客服
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
\ No newline at end of file
diff --git a/pages.json b/pages.json
index cca81fa..0f558ff 100644
--- a/pages.json
+++ b/pages.json
@@ -639,6 +639,15 @@
"titleNView": false
}
}
+ },{
+ "path": "order/paydingMs",
+ "style": {
+ "navigationBarTitleText": "秒杀订单",
+ "enablePullDownRefresh": false,
+ "app-plus": {
+ "titleNView": false
+ }
+ }
},{
"path": "order/payModifyTcMyDaiB",
"style": {
diff --git a/pages/my/newseckill.vue b/pages/my/newseckill.vue
index 11eecd8..411d5f5 100644
--- a/pages/my/newseckill.vue
+++ b/pages/my/newseckill.vue
@@ -50,22 +50,24 @@
{{item.title}}
+ {{item.classifyName}}
-
-
- 秒杀价¥
- {{item.price}}
-
-
- 原价¥{{item.oldPrice}}
-
-
+
+ ¥
+ {{item.price}}
+ /{{item.serviceCount}}次
+ ¥
+ {{item.oldPrice}}/{{item.serviceCount}}次
-
- {{item.startTime}}
-
-
- 开抢
+
+ {{tag}}
+
+
+
+ 已售{{item.sales}}
+
+
+ 查看
@@ -89,7 +91,8 @@
serviceTrue:true,
page:1,
limit:10,
- titleNmae:''
+ titleNmae:'',
+ tagsData:[]
}
},
onLoad(){
@@ -106,31 +109,20 @@
this.getData()
}
},
- getTimeInMilliseconds(timeString) {
- return new Date(timeString).getTime();
- },
getData(){
let data = {
+ userId: this.myId,
type: '112',
page: this.page,
limit: this.limit,
title:this.searchValue,
}
- this.$Request.get('/app/massage/package/findAppActivityPage', data).then(res => {
+ this.$Request.get('/app/user/package/findMyPackageList', data).then(res => {
if (res.code == 0) {
- var newTime = new Date().getTime();
- var starTime;
- var endTime;
- for(var i=0;i=starTime&&newTime<=endTime){
- this.$set(res.data.list[i], 'btnShow', true)
- }else{
- this.$set(res.data.list[i], 'btnShow', false)
- }
+ this.dataList=res.data.records;
+ for(var i=0;i {
+ this.$Request.get('/app/user/package/findMyPackageList',params).then(res => {
// 将请求的结果数组传递给z-paging
- this.$refs.paging.complete(res.data.list);
- var newTime = new Date().getTime();
- var starTime;
- var endTime;
- for(var i=0;i=starTime&&newTime<=endTime){
- this.$set(res.data.list[i], 'btnShow', true)
- }else{
- this.$set(res.data.list[i], 'btnShow', false)
- }
- }
- this.dataList=res.data.list;
+ this.$refs.paging.complete(res.data.records);
}).catch(res => {
// 如果请求失败写this.$refs.paging.complete(false);
// 注意,每次都需要在catch中写这句话很麻烦,z-paging提供了方案可以全局统一处理
@@ -186,7 +165,7 @@
},
itemClick(item) {
uni.navigateTo({
- url:'/pages/my/newseckilldetails?id='+item.id+'&limit='+this.limit+'&page='+this.page+'&name='+'index'
+ url:'/pages/my/newseckilldetails?id='+item.id+'&limit='+this.limit+'&page='+this.page+'&name='+'my'
})
}
}
diff --git a/pages/my/newseckilldetails.vue b/pages/my/newseckilldetails.vue
index 87fad65..5981456 100644
--- a/pages/my/newseckilldetails.vue
+++ b/pages/my/newseckilldetails.vue
@@ -620,8 +620,16 @@
page: that.page,
limit: that.limit,
}
- that.$Request.get('/app/user/package/detail/findMyPackageDetailList', data).then(res => {
+ that.$Request.get('/app/massage/package/getAppFlashDetail', data).then(res => {
if (res.code == 0) {
+ var newTime = new Date().getTime();
+ var starTime=this.getTimeInMilliseconds(res.data.startTime);
+ var endTime=this.getTimeInMilliseconds(res.data.endTime);
+ if(newTime>=starTime&&newTime<=endTime){
+ this.$set(res.data, 'btnShow', true)
+ }else{
+ this.$set(res.data, 'btnShow', false)
+ }
that.mainData=res.data.mainData;
that.detailData=res.data.detailData;
that.contentImg=that.mainData.contentImg.split(",");
diff --git a/pages/videoCircle/index.vue b/pages/videoCircle/index.vue
index da85e97..1e5ebd8 100644
--- a/pages/videoCircle/index.vue
+++ b/pages/videoCircle/index.vue
@@ -1,451 +1,780 @@
-
-
-
- 系统建设中,敬请期待!
-
-
-
-
-
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+ {{list.dzs}}
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+ {{list.content}}
+
+
+
+
+
+
+
+
+
+
+
+
+
+
-
+
+
+
+
+
+
-
+
-
+
\ No newline at end of file
+ .likeNumActive{
+ color: red;
+ }
+ .content{
+ width: 620rpx;
+ z-index: 99;
+ position: absolute;
+ bottom: 50px;
+ /* justify-content: center; */
+ padding: 15rpx;
+ flex-direction: column;
+ justify-content: flex-start;
+ color: #ffffff;
+ z-index: 12;
+ /* background-color: aqua; */
+ }
+ .userName {
+ font-size: 30rpx;
+ color: #ffffff;
+ margin-top: 80upx;
+ }
+ .words {
+ margin-top: 10rpx;
+ font-size: 30rpx;
+ color: #ffffff;
+ }
+ .root{
+ background-color: #000000;
+ }
+
diff --git a/pages/videoCircle/index111.vue b/pages/videoCircle/index111.vue
deleted file mode 100644
index fca0ec7..0000000
--- a/pages/videoCircle/index111.vue
+++ /dev/null
@@ -1,762 +0,0 @@
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
- {{list.like_n}}
-
-
-
-
-
-
- 分享
-
-
-
-
-
-
-
-
-
-
- {{list.title}}
- {{list.msg}}-{{k+1}}
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
diff --git a/pages/videoCircle/index22.vue b/pages/videoCircle/index22.vue
new file mode 100644
index 0000000..da85e97
--- /dev/null
+++ b/pages/videoCircle/index22.vue
@@ -0,0 +1,451 @@
+
+
+
+
+ 系统建设中,敬请期待!
+
+
+
+
+
+
+
+
+
+
+
+
+
+
\ No newline at end of file